Question Without Notice No. 1222 asked in the Legislative Council on 16 December 2021 by Hon Peter Collier

Parliament: 41 Session: 1

FIONA STANLEY HOSPITAL — ICT SHUTDOWN

1222. Hon PETER COLLIER to the minister representing the Minister for Health:

I refer the minister to the shutdown of the IT system at Fiona Stanley Hospital on or about 16 November 2021.

(1) Was the shutdown a result of a firewall failure as reported?

(2) If no to (1), what was the cause of the shutdown?

(3) What has been done to prevent such an outage into the future?

Hon MATTHEW SWINBOURN replied:

On behalf of the minister representing the Minister for Health, I thank the member for some notice of the question. I provide the following response based on the information provided to me by the Minister for Health.

(1) No.

(2) The cause of the shutdown was a software defect within a core ICT network infrastructure switch.

(3) Based on vendor advice, following considerable analysis of the problem, a software upgrade was applied to the core ICT network infrastructure switch. Monitoring of the equipment is continuing and the system has been stable since the upgrade.
